Express yourself through costume design

In the Costume Design degree program, you’ll be encouraged to expand your artistic and visual expression through clothing design.

You’ll work closely with faculty members, production teams and DePaul’s Costume Shop to design costumes for multiple public productions by The Theatre School.

In your fourth year of the degree program, you’ll complete an internship in the costume industry to gain real-world experience. At the end of your fourth year, you will have the chance to take part in the annual Graduate Showcase, where you will present your designs to artistic directors and other members of the theatre, film and television industries.

Classes

Coursework

  • Costume Technology
  • Drawing for Designers
  • Design Production
  • History of Dramatic Literature
  • Historical Significance of Costuming
  • Stage Make-up

Career Options

Common Career Areas

  • Advertising
  • Commercial costuming
  • Fashion design
  • Film costuming
  • Magazine costuming
  • Retail display design
  • Television costuming
  • Theatre costuming​
